Graffiti spaghetti - 15th December 2023
This special kind of art is 'graffiti spaghetti'. Sam Cox is the artist. His art uses doodles. The doodles tell a story. The story is about Mr Doodle in Doodleland. Mr Doodle visited a Hong Kong metro station.
Cox likes to be Mr Doodle.
Sam Cox: "And it's just very fun and surreal and kind of eccentric. And that's really the inspiration behind kind of becoming like Mr Doodle, and wearing the Doodle outfit and trying to embody the character as much as possible, really."
Cox loves making art in public places. He likes drawing with other people. At the station, 10 children drew with him.
They all drew on a spaceship. They're sending Mr Doodle on a space adventure. Some children used his graffiti spaghetti style. Other children had their own style.
People watched them draw. Cox loves sharing this experience with people.
Sam Cox: "I really, I really enjoyed doing the live performances in front of people because I love to be able to give people an insight into the process of how it is to create one of my pieces. And I love sharing that with people."
Cox's art is famous. It's expensive too. People of all ages love his art. Pearl Lam sells Mr Doodle's art. She says it makes people happy.
Pearl Lam: "I think in this very modern commercial world, you need some relaxation, you need some joy and, joy and happiness. And that's what Mr Doodle give and also is engaging younger generation. So, his work speaks to all different nationalities. And it gives them such joy and some happiness."
Mr Doodle had a fun adventure in the station. And he's now ready to go home to Doodleland.
Sam Cox: "And then eventually, they reach back to Doodleland and have this kind of battle. So, it's really the journey through space is, is what the exhibition is all about."
